Knowing Fluid Cleaning: Main Points and Instances
Mechanical Cleaning is a procedure utilized to decontaminate ducts by inserting a gadget, known as a blocker, into the channel and driving it along with liquids. Basically, pigging eliminates buildup of deposits, such as scale, which can limit flow effectiveness. Inclusive Pigging System: From Launcher to Receiver
A typical pigging setup comprises numerous key constituents, working jointly to ensure efficient conduit maintenance. The process originates with the insertion location, where the sphere is inserted into the pipe. Following this, the sphere moves down the pipe, propelled by the momentum. Finally, the exit point retrieves the device, often featuring a splitting system to remove it from the pipeline and prepare it for overhaul or getting rid. This overall structure necessitates exact fabrication and routine inspection for peak performance.
